Why "Pressure" is Often the Enemy of Your Property
Most people in the Greater Glasgow area don't realize that high-pressure water can actually be destructive. If you use a standard power washer on your roof tiles, K-Rend roughcast, or delicate sandstone, you risk:
Water Ingress: Forcing water behind seals and into wall cavities.
Surface Erosion: Stripping the protective "face" off bricks and stones.
Rapid Regrowth: Pressure washing often just "mows the lawn," leaving the roots of moss and algae deep inside the substrate to grow back faster than before.
The Science of the "Sanitized Home"
In a climate as damp as Scotland’s, our homes aren't just "dirty"—they are infected. The black streaks on your render and the green slime on your fence are living organisms: Gloeocapsa magma (bacteria), algae, and fungi.
Our Soft Washing process uses biodegradable, HSE-approved solutions that kill these spores at the root. Think of it as pest control for your walls. By the time we rinse the surface with the pressure of a garden hose, the biological load is gone, leaving a surface that stays clean up to 4x longer than traditional jet washing.
